29. A day is either gained or lost when one moves across longitude ​

Answer:

If you are travelling westward, you gain a day, and if you are travelling eastward, you lose a day.

Step-by-step explanation:

For example, if a traveler moves eastward across the Pacific Ocean from Wake Island to the Hawaiian Islands on June 25, they will jump backward to June 24 as soon as they cross the IDL.
